    Vortex Skyline 80 20-60x Zoom eyepiece replacement

    Just want to throw in a mini review on this scope. The image is bright and clear all the way up to 40x One drawback to this scope and a reason why I may return it, is that the focusing is stiff, extremely slow and awkward! Love the cordura case that came with it, very nice touch!
